The Best Happy Hours in Scottsdale

Where to Go At Day's End

Although the Scottsdale happy hour scene is crowded and always in flux, here are four stand-out restaurants and bars where you can always find a good time.

Cafe Zuzu. Happy hour is Monday through Friday from 3pm to 7pm at this hip cafe and bar, located at the mid-century chic Hotel Valley Ho. Not only are the handcrafted cocktails something write home about, the happy hour appetizers are outstanding. Try the grilled cheese with tomato soup, featuring fontina cheese melted to perfection on sourdough bread. Hungry? Try the Mini Pork Shanks, or the Prime Rib Dip, which will leave you licking your fingers and asking for more. The happy hour drink selection includes wine by the glass, beer specials, and discounts on the house specialty cocktails. For a refreshing way to cap off your day, try the Pomegranate Fizz, Smirnoff vodka with pomegranate juice and sparkling wine.

5th and Wine. This wine bar/restaurant is an Old Town Scottsdale favorite. Come by for the popular Happy Hour, which happens from 3pm-6pm every Monday through Friday. Don't be fooled by the wine bar atmosphere: 5th and Wine is also one of the best restaurants in Old Town. Sample the great Happy Hour fare, which includes prosciutto-wrapped breadsticks, spicy chicken drumettes, crispy french fries, caesar salad, and the signature bruschetta, prepared with a variety of different gourmet toppings. Drink specials include $4 draft beer and well drinks and $5 wine by the glass. The atmosphere here is lively, friendly, and warm, making this a great place for a fun and low-key happy hour with friends.

Loco Patron. One of the best Mexican restaurant happy hours in Scottsdale is at Loco Patron, a popular gathering spot for those craving delicious Mexican food and drinks. The patio is always hopping during happy hour, which happens daily from 3pm-7pm. Drink specials include $3 domestic and Mexican beers, $5 classic Margaritas, $3 KamiKazi shots, $3 glass of wine, $5 Skinny Margaritas, and $10 for the restaurant's famous Jumbo Margarita. Margarita aficionados will want to try the restaurant's signature flavors, which include Mango, Chambord, Strawberry, Cactus Pear, Peach, Wild Berry and Pomegranate.

Culinary Dropout. This hip new gastropub offers one of the swankiest happy hours in town, every Monday through Friday from 3pm-6pm. Foodies will want to flock to Culinary Dropout just to sample the happy hour menu, which features gourmet cheeses such as Dolce Gorgonzola and Manchego, along with hard-to-find meats like Capicola (a mild spice, cured pork) and Prosciutto di San Daniele (salted pork imported from Italy). Other happy hour snacks include cured olives, marcona almonds, crusty bread with olive oil, pretzels served with provolone fondue, and the delicious house french fries. Drink specials include $3 mug beers and $4 well cocktails. There is live music several nights a week on the outdoor patio.
